Reggie Sanders Lists Family Home

Despite playing for the Arizona Diamondbacks for only one year in 2001, retired MLB player Reggie Sanders decided to put down roots in the Scottsdale region, in part because the area's school system is so great. Reggie, whose career spanned 17 seasons, just listed his Scottsdale, Arizona family home for $2.195 million, a house he and his family have lived in since 2002. View the listing.
